On the morning of August 25, a tattered old U.S. military plane stopped at the Dongguan Airport in Yan'an, built with cattle and stones. The aircraft provided by the US military is a Douglas transport aircraft, green color, two propellers, the hatch is short, according to General Yang Dezhi later recalled, due to long-term use, the door has not been closed tightly, the propeller at take-off also depends on people to push, it is said that the flight technology of this US military pilot is really superb. Under the small window of the aircraft cabin are iron seats, the cabin plate is curved, and passengers sit on stools on both sides of the fuselage, sitting down straight, unable to lift their heads. However, the biggest advantage of this aircraft is that it can land as long as there is a large flat land.

The plane bumped all the way, and finally arrived at the Changning Temporary Airport in Licheng County, southeastern Shanxi, after more than 4 hours.

Changning Airport is located in Changning Village, Dongyangguan Town, Licheng County, Shanxi Province, which is a temporary airport built in August 1944 in the Jinji-Hebei Luyu Border District to facilitate the take-off and landing of US aircraft. It is said that the airport is actually a runway made of loess, there is no common airport facilities such as command, navigation, fire protection, etc. Every time the plane lands, the only sign used to guide the plane to land is a pile of lit firewood.

This changning top-secret airlift lasted only four or five hours, and the whole process from planning to realization was only a few days, but no one would have thought that it was this seemingly ordinary flight completed by the US pilots, in fact

A strategic airlift played an extremely unusual role in the subsequent decisive battle between the Kuomintang and the Communists and in the evolution of China's modern history.

It was precisely this airlift that enabled the Communist Party to complete the transportation task, which would have required two months of arduous trekking, to be completed within half a day. These bravest and most warlike generals of the CHINESE Communists arrived in the theater one step ahead of the enemy, quickly assembled the main force, organized the field corps, calmly and freely selected the battlefield and fighters, put the enemy in a passive and unfavorable situation, and then won the battle.
